响应式设计是现代网页开发中不可或缺的一部分,它确保网站在不同设备上都能提供良好的用户体验。无论用户使用的是桌面电脑、平板还是手机,网页内容都能自动调整布局和尺寸。
实现响应式设计的关键在于使用灵活的网格布局和媒体查询。通过设置不同的断点,可以根据屏幕宽度改变元素的排列方式。例如,在小屏幕上,导航栏可以折叠为汉堡菜单,而在大屏幕上则显示为水平导航。
AI绘图结果,仅供参考
图片和媒体元素也需要适配不同分辨率。使用CSS的max-width属性可以让图片在容器内自动缩放,避免溢出或变形。同时,srcset属性能根据设备性能加载合适大小的图片,提升加载速度。
字体大小和间距同样需要动态调整。使用相对单位如em或rem代替固定像素,能让文字在不同屏幕上保持可读性。•合理设置视口(viewport)元标签,确保移动端正确渲染页面。
测试是确保响应式设计成功的重要环节。开发者可以使用浏览器的开发者工具模拟多种设备,检查布局是否流畅。实际测试不同设备上的表现,能发现潜在问题并及时优化。
最终,响应式设计不仅提升了用户体验,也提高了网站的可访问性和搜索引擎排名。通过持续学习和实践,开发者能够打造更高效、更友好的网页体验。